It is odd and surreal for me to live near a major harbour. I was never really a see faring kinda guy. I have been on ferries, but never on a cruise ship, though I admit I would love to get passage on a container ship to somewhere in Asia…..

But now living at English Bay I see ships coming and going pretty much all the time and it is almost eerie how silent they seem to move. You see them coming from the distance, turn towards the bay, then turn by and anchor, waiting for their time to get into the harbour to load their cargo.

Two days ago I was sitting at the beach, staring out at the water when two container ships or tankers (I am not sure really), came into the bay, turned by and then anchored.

Yesterday I was at Canada Place from which you can see the container ships dock and be loaded / unloaded when the ship berthed there fired up it’s engines, resulting in a huge, thick black cloud of fumes covering the terminal for a couple of minutes, then pushing back and turning towards the Burrad Inlet. I was walking along the see wall why this monster of a ship was slowly making it ‘s way down the strait and I couldn’t really hear the engine…. It was impressive. I then saw it take course towards the open sea and from my living room window it disappeared into the distant.

One of the other ships then turned into the harbour. All seemed to have happened silently…. Colour me impressed.
